需求分析
在开始PHP网站建设之前,首先要进行需求分析。这一阶段需要与用户充分沟通,明确网站的功能定位、目标用户、业务需求等。只有充分理解用户需求,才能设计出符合用户期望的网站。
系统设计
在需求分析的基础上,进行系统设计。这包括网站的整体架构设计、数据库设计、模块划分等。PHP网站架构应具备高内聚、低耦合的特点,便于后期维护和扩展。数据库设计要考虑到数据的存储、检索效率以及数据安全性。
数据库管理
PHP网站建设离不开数据库的支持。数据库管理包括数据结构设计、数据存储、数据备份与恢复等。要选择合适的数据库类型,如MySQL、Oracle等,并针对网站的特性进行优化,确保数据的快速、安全访问。
编程实现
编程实现是PHP网站建设的核心环节。根据系统设计,使用PHP语言进行编程,实现网站的各种功能。在编程过程中,要注意代码的可读性、可维护性以及安全性。要遵循PHP的最佳实践,提高网站的运行效率。
测试与发布
在编程完成后,要进行严格的测试,确保网站的各项功能正常运行。测试包括功能测试、性能测试、安全测试等。在测试过程中,要及时修复发现的问题。测试通过后,即可进行网站的发布。发布前要确保所有功能均已完善,并做好网站的优化工作。
后期维护与优化
网站发布后,还需要进行后期的维护与优化工作。这包括定期更新内容、修复漏洞、优化性能等。要根据用户反馈和市场变化,不断改进网站的功能和用户体验。
PHP网站建设是一个复杂的过程,需要多方面的知识与技能。只有充分理解用户需求,进行科学的系统设计,确保数据库的安全与高效,编写出高质量的代码,并经过严格的测试与发布流程,才能建设出一个符合用户期望的PHP网站。后期的维护与优化也是确保网站长期稳定运行的关键。